Thomas Tuchel confirms Callum Hudson-Odoi was denied move
Chelsea manager Thomas Tuchel has confirmed that Callum Hudson-Odoi was denied a loan move to Borussia Dortmund this summer.
Hudson-Odoi has struggled for regular minutes with the Blues. He was linked with a late loan switch to Dortmund last month.
However, the Blues were never expected to sanction the deal, and Tuchel has now confirmed that a move was 'impossible'.
While Hudson-Odoi wanted to join Dortmund, Tuchel said that it was a fairly easy decision to keep the graduate at the club.
Hudson-Odoi prefers to play on the left-wing, but he can't do so with Tuchel's 3-4-2-1 formation with two attacking midfielders.
Hence, he has operated from the right wing-back position. He was handed a start against Aston Villa in the Premier League on Saturday.
His game time could be limited. It is likely that he will drop to the bench when the Blues return to Champions League action in midweek.
They are scheduled to host Zenit St Petersburg. Reece James is widely expected to start in the right wing-back position.
